NAIROBI, Kenya — The pinnacle of Kenya’s electoral fee introduced on Monday that William Ruto, the nation’s vice chairman, had gained the presidential election. However the validity of the consequence was thrown into doubt due to an announcement minutes earlier by a majority of the election commissioners that they may not stand by the result.

In a speech simply after the announcement, Mr. Ruto stated: “All sovereign energy belongs to the folks of Kenya. I need to thank God for getting us so far. I need to thank God that at the moment we have now concluded this election.”

He described the vote as “a really historic, democratic event that strikes our nation to the following stage.”

“I do know many are questioning, particularly those that have achieved many issues in opposition to us, I need to inform them they don’t have anything to worry,” he added. “There isn’t any room for vengeance, there isn’t any room for wanting again, we want to the long run.”

The election pitted two of the nation’s political heavyweights in opposition to one another: Mr. Ruto is the nation’s vice chairman, whereas Raila Odinga is a veteran opposition chief who has misplaced 4 earlier election runs.

Kenya is East Africa’s greatest economic system, and it’s pivotal not just for the soundness of the area, however as a hub for commerce and safety. The presidential race, Kenya’s closest because the nation’s first really aggressive election 20 years in the past, can be being carefully scrutinized by Western and regional allies as a key take a look at for democracy in one in all Africa’s powerhouse nations.

Mr. Ruto, 55, additionally a rich businessman, solid himself as a champion of Kenya’s “hustler nation” — the disillusioned, largely younger strivers struggling to achieve a foothold.

A vice chairwoman of the Unbiased Electoral and Boundaries Fee, Juliana Cherera, talking on behalf of 4 of the nation’s seven commissioners stated the panel couldn’t take possession of the outcomes due to the “opaque nature” of the election’s dealing with.

Celebrations broke out in Eldoret city, a Ruto stronghold, instantly after the announcement, with a deafening cacophony of automobiles and bike horns, whistling and screaming filling the streets within the downtown space. The group waved posters with Mr. Ruto’s face and donned yellow T-shirts and scarves consistent with his get together’s official colours. Lots of these celebrating additionally waved leaves of the sinendet plant, which locals use to garland winners. “We gained!” they screamed. “Ruto did it!”
